Tnconnect Credit Union
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 2,542,752 | 2,536,226 | 6,526 | 207.7 | 35% |
| 2012 | 2,350,699 | 2,335,400 | 15,299 | 228.8 | 37% |
| 2013 | 2,158,975 | 2,322,333 | −163,358 | 234.3 | 36% |
| 2014 | 2,077,319 | 2,169,238 | −91,919 | 256.2 | 35% |
| 2015 | 2,284,917 | 2,180,894 | 104,023 | 269.3 | 35% |
| 2016 | 2,387,172 | 2,315,716 | 71,456 | 261.4 | 32% |
| 2017 | 2,480,004 | 2,510,942 | −30,938 | 243.2 | 32% |
| 2018 | 2,684,727 | 2,585,810 | 98,917 | 247.1 | 28% |
| 2019 | 2,808,922 | 2,678,813 | 130,109 | 246.4 | 30% |
| 2020 | 3,075,596 | 2,838,063 | 237,533 | 281.7 | 29% |
| 2021 | 3,238,236 | 2,760,019 | 478,217 | 333.4 | 32% |
| 2022 | 3,064,616 | 2,850,163 | 214,453 | 322.9 | 32% |
| 2023 | 3,655,647 | 3,302,039 | 353,608 | 266.3 | 32%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$353,608 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 266.3 months of spending, up from 207.7 in 2011. Staff pay was 32%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
